The Florida Department of Agriculture and Consumer Services is soliciting competitive bids for a marsh restoration project involving the planting of Sand Cordgrass within the Okaloacoochee Slough State Forest in Felda, Florida. The scope of work includes the planting of up to 50 acres of Spartina bakeri to support environmental restoration efforts in the region. This solicitation, identified as ITB FFS 26 27 46, was posted on September 1, 2026, with a response deadline of September 23, 2026.
